Smyth sewing is a method of bookbinding where groups of folded pages (referred to as signatures) are stitched together using binder thread. Each folded signature is sewn together individually with multiple stitches and then joined with other signatures to create the complete book block. This is the traditional and best method of bookbinding.

This exciting collection features knitted blocks in all shapes and sizes, each with a floral theme, some taken from traditional sources and many completely new designs. Offering a mixture of knitting techniques from intarsia and color work to raised effects and open, lacy stitches, the blocks also range from simple corner-to-corner squares to geometric shapes worked in the round. Each design includes written instructions and, where appropriate, charts with symbols or colors. Includes a Useful Techniques section to help improve your knitting skills.
